Banking and Financial Support Services is the 457th most popular major in the country with 1,135 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 13 banking and financial support services graduates with average earnings and debt of $56,398 and $43,194 respectively.

This year’s “Best Value Banking and Financial Support Services Schools for a Master’s For Those Making $30-$48k” ranking analyzed 3 colleges that offered a degree in banking and financial support services.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ality banking and financial support services program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

When determining these rankings, we looked at things such as overall quality of the banking and financial support services program at the school and the cost to attend the school once aid has been awarded. Check out our ranking methodology for more information.

Top 3 Best Value Master’s Degree Colleges for Banking and Financial Support Services (Income $30-$48k)

#1

Boston University

Boston, Massachusetts
#1 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Boston University.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Banking and Financial Support Services Schools for a Master’s For Those Making $30-$48k list. This large school is located in Boston, Massachusetts, and it awarded 3 masters’s banking and financial support services degrees in 2019-2020.

In addition to being on our master’s degree banking and financial support services students whose families make $30-$48k list, Boston U has also earned the #1 rank in our “Best Banking and Financial Support Services Master’s Degree Schools”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at Boston U are $57,666,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.

#2

University of Houston

Houston, Texas
#2 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Houston.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Banking and Financial Support Services Schools for a Master’s For Those Making $30-$48k list. UH is a large school located in Houston, Texas that handed out 6 masters’s banking and financial support services degrees in 2019-2020.

In addition to being on our master’s degree banking and financial support services students whose families make $30-$48k list, UH has also earned the #2 rank in our “Best Banking and Financial Support Services Master’s Degree Schools”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at UH are $18,689,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.

#3

Northern State University

Aberdeen, South Dakota
#3 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Northern State University. The school came in at #3 for the Best Value Banking and Financial Support Services Schools for a Master’s For Those Making $30-$48k. NSU is a small school located in Aberdeen, South Dakota that handed out 3 masters’s banking and financial support services degrees in 2019-2020.

NSU also took the #3 spot in our “Best Banking and Financial Support Services Master’s Degree Schools”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at NSU are $11,814,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
